Definition
Stablecoin risk is the possibility that a stablecoin loses value, liquidity, transferability, backing, redemption access, legal availability, or operational usefulness. Overview
Stablecoin risk is the possibility that a stablecoin loses value, liquidity, transferability, backing, redemption access, legal availability, or operational usefulness.
The risk comes from issuers, reserves, collateral, banks, custodians, smart contracts, oracles, liquidations, governance, bridges, networks, exchanges, and regulation. Low price volatility during normal markets does not mean low risk, because losses can appear suddenly when confidence, liquidity, or redemption fails. Major risk categories include depeg, insolvency, censorship, contract exploit, bridge failure, collateral collapse, bank outage, legal restriction, concentration, and operational error.
